Explanation:

The Taj Mahal, one of the most famous monuments in the world, is located in Agra, Uttar Pradesh, India. It was commissioned by Mughal Emperor Shah Jahan in memory of his beloved wife, Mumtaz Mahal, who died in 1631. The construction of the Taj Mahal began in 1632 and was completed in 1653, making it a significant example of Mughal architecture.

Mughal architecture is known for its grandeur, intricate designs, and the use of white marble. The Taj Mahal is a prime example of this style, featuring a large white marble dome, minarets, and intricate carvings and inlays. The construction of the Taj Mahal involved thousands of artisans and craftsmen, and it took approximately 22 years to complete.

The Taj Mahal is not only a symbol of love but also a testament to the architectural and artistic achievements of the Mughal Empire. It is considered one of the finest examples of Mughal architecture and is rec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site.
